Rage Review : The expansion problem of Bitcoin blockchain has always been the crux of its wide applicability, so SegWit was proposed and tested many times. At present, it seems that this is still the most reasonable and effective way. Including the Thunder Network project previously announced by Blockchain, it will also integrate SegWit to try to solve the problem of slow transaction speed of Bitcoin blockchain. The latest news this month pointed out that the upcoming 0.13.1 version of Bitcoin software will add SegWit code; and in order to realize this function, most nodes must be upgraded. Translation: Annie_Xu The Bitcoin software is about to be upgraded again, and the Segregated Witness (SegWit) code will be added first. Later, in order to expand the number of transactions that the Bitcoin blockchain can handle, the code will be activated. The newly added code for SegWit is being called the “most significant code change” in version 0.13.0 of the bitcoin software; however, the change is not intended to activate SegWit itself, but rather to eventually deploy it in version 0.13.1. A software upgrade is expected to be released in the coming weeks. Although the SegWit feature has been repeatedly tested, bitcoin developers hope to democratize testing by activating the feature on the bitcoin testnet and in “regression testing mode”; that is, allowing many developers to independently test it and submit potential issues and vulnerabilities. Bitcoin Core developers believe that SegWit will be more secure and stable after adding these codes. In order to solve Bitcoin's long-standing block size problem, developers proposed SegWit in December last year, hoping to maintain the original block size while increasing transaction volume; block size uses hard encryption to limit the amount of data that can be contained in a transaction block. In order for the code change to be implemented, a soft fork must be initiated; the majority of nodes must be upgraded to make it compatible with the previous software version. The software release also includes other code upgrade features, such as fee filtering that allows nodes to determine to whom to pass transactions; and compact block relay that can reduce the bandwidth required for blocks to propagate across the network. |
